Rotary Club’s Share The Warmth Clothing Drive
The Rotary Club’s Share the Warmth clothing drive was a great success. Ten containers of clothing collected were delivered to the Coastal Street Medicine Program on the 18th.

There’s a wind advisory for the Mendocino Coast until noon. Gusty winds of up to 25 mph with 45 mph gusts expected. Power outages may result. Falling tree limbs and blowing debris may occur.

An accident killed two people mid-evening on Tuesday on Route 20 west of Upper Lake near Witter Springs Road at mile marker 6 in Lake County. Emergency responders reported two fatalities and an unknown number of people with serious injuries. Route 20 was completely closed for a time. An investigation is underway.

A high surf warning continues for Mendocino Coast, Coastal Del Norte, and Southwestern Humboldt counties through this evening. Breaking waves can sweep people off jetties and docks, and create life-threatening surfing conditions. Mariners traversing the bar are urged to exercise extreme caution or stay in port until the threat subsides.

The state’s jobless rate, including that in Lake County, rose slightly in November. The state rose one-tenth of a percent and in Lake County rose from 5.7% in October to 6.1% in November, the highest since March, which was 6.4.
